#604369 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#604369 is composed of 37.6% red, 26.3%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.6% cyan, 36.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 285.8 degrees, a saturation of 22.1% and a lightness of 33.7%. #604369 color hex could be obtained by blending #c086d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#604369 color description : Very dark desaturated magenta.
#604369 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#604369 has RGB values of R:96, G:67,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6308713.
